Shohei Omokawa is a scholar working on Surgery, Rehabilitation and Epidemiology. According to data from OpenAlex, Shohei Omokawa has authored 131 papers receiving a total of 1.7k indexed citations (citations by other indexed papers that have themselves been cited), including 117 papers in Surgery, 61 papers in Rehabilitation and 28 papers in Epidemiology. Recurrent topics in Shohei Omokawa’s work include Orthopedic Surgery and Rehabilitation (92 papers), Elbow and Forearm Trauma Treatment (59 papers) and Reconstructive Surgery and Microvascular Techniques (26 papers). Shohei Omokawa is often cited by papers focused on Orthopedic Surgery and Rehabilitation (92 papers), Elbow and Forearm Trauma Treatment (59 papers) and Reconstructive Surgery and Microvascular Techniques (26 papers). Shohei Omokawa collaborates with scholars based in Japan, Thailand and United States. Shohei Omokawa's co-authors include Yasuhito Tanaka, Jaiyoung Ryu, Akio Iida, Manabu Akahane, Takamasa Shimizu, Ryotaro Fujitani, Hiroshi Yajima, Yoshinori Takakura, Hisao Moritomo and Tadanobu Onishi and has published in prestigious journals such as Spine, Clinical Orthopaedics and Related Research and Plastic & Reconstructive Surgery.
